Transaction 1122516626ec22cc19846fa58a08e14785a8be07c667209cbb4c9e076ca3da7d
1 Input
2 Outputs
- 1122516626ec22cc19846fa58a08e14785a8be07c667209cbb4c9e076ca3da7d:0
- 1122516626ec22cc19846fa58a08e14785a8be07c667209cbb4c9e076ca3da7d:1
value 8276
address 1LRKFefP43VgDQUgDgSwH9oYVxCgfJbE8V
value 88087
address 35uLRAGWDQVKYw3QcHmqRVa3vP2184BAg4